We present a real-time reverse radiosity method for compensating indirect scattering effects that occur with immersive and semi-immersive projection displays. It computes a numerical solution directly on the GPU and is implemented with pixel shading and multi-pass rendering which together realizes a Jacobi solver for sparse matrix linear equation systems. Our method is validated and evaluated based on a stereoscopic two-sided wall display. The images appear more brilliant and uniform when compensating the scattering contribution.
